The 1991 Monie A. Ferst Award and Medal will be presented to
Manuel Blum on Friday, May 10, 1991 at the Georgia Institute of Technology
in Atlanta, Georgia. The annual Award is the primary means that Sigma Xi,
the scientific research society, honors nationally distinguished
scientists (over all fields). A symposium in Dr. Blum's honor will
be held on the Georgia Tech campus, to be followed by an awards
banquet in the evening. The speakers at the symposium are four of
the many prominent scientists that have been Dr. Blum's students.
We would be delighted to have interested parties attend the symposium.
Note that it is in the same week as this year's STOC meeting.
Dana Angluin What have I learned about learning?
Mike Sipser Circuit Complexity
Steven Rudich Black Box Cryptography
Len Adleman T-cell Regeneration Following Selective CD4+
Cell Depletion: A New Look at the Pathogenisis of AIDS
Manuel Blum ---concluding remarks
The talks will be held in the Microelectronics Research Center at
Georgia Tech. A detailed schedule, directions to the symposium,
hotel information, etc. will be available shortly via email.
